Another quick question guys!!
The Tuono I'm picking up on saturday had an Aprilia Racing Ti can fitted (plus original) but have heard they are VERY loud???? Is this true?? Do they come with baffles??? Just that i'm going to be starting the bike at about 0630 in the morning for my dayshifts and...